템플릿(3)
-
3. 튜토리얼 따라하기 - 설문조사 - 3
3.14. 제네릭 뷰 사용하기 제네릭 뷰는 장고에서 미리 준비한 뷰를 말합니다. 웹 프로그래밍에 일반적으로 사용되는 뷰들은 이미 장고에서 대부분 만들어 뒀습니다. 이것들을 사용하면 코드를 적게 사용하고 기능들을 빠르게 완성할 수 있습니다. 다음 코드를 참조하여 views.py를 수정합니다. 기존에 있던 index, detail, results 뷰는 삭제합니다. from django.views import generic from .models import Question, Choice class IndexView(generic.ListView): template_name='polls/index.html' context_object_name='latest_question_list' def get_querys..
2019.05.28 -
1. 부트스트랩소개와 사용방법 - 2
1. 기본적인 반응형 웹 페이지 예제 부트스트랩 웹사이트에는 다양한 예제 페이지들이 있습니다. 간단하게 예제 하나를 살펴보겠습니다. 부트스트랩 스타터 템플릿이라는 페이지입니다. 아주 평범한 웹 페이지인데, 이 웹페이지의 폭을 변화시켜 보면 변화되는 것을 알 수 있습니다. 즉 웹 페이지가 가변적으로 변화할 때, 반응형 웹페이지로 바뀌는 것을 알 수 있습니다.부트스트랩 스타터 템플릿 - 브라우저 크기를 줄이기 전 - - 브라우저 크기를 줄인 후 - - 토글 버튼 클릭 시 - 부트스트랩은 기본적으로 반응형 웹 페이지를 만들어 주지만, 경우에 따라 반응형 웹 페이지가 필요 없거나, 어드민 페이지와 같이 반응형 웹페이지로 만들면 안되는 경우가 있습니다.부트스트랩에서 반응형 웹 페이지를 생성하지 않게 하는 방법은 ..
2018.02.08 -
Sublime Text Snippet(템플릿파일) 생성하기
1. Sublime Text3를 실행합니다. 2. 메뉴바에서 'Tools -> Developer -> New Snippet'을 클릭합니다. 3. 자동으로 다음과 같은 코드가 작성돼 있습니다. 4. 3행이 자동으로 생성될 코드부분으로 'Hello, $ is a $.'코드를 삭제하고 생성할 코드를 작성합니다. 5. 주석으로 표시된 부분에서 주석을 제거하고 'tabTrigger'를 활성화한 후 'hello'를 삭제하고 템플릿을 불러올 단어를 문자나 문자열을 입력합니다. 6. 'Ctrl + S'를 눌러 '파일명.sublime-snippet'으로 작성하고, 저장 경로는 변경하지 않고 저장하면 됩니다. 7. 테스트를 하기 위해 메뉴바에서 'File -> New File'을 클릭 or 'Ctrl + N'을 눌러 새로..
2017.04.07